The product line sealed with the new purity grade "Eppendorf Forensic DNA Grade" complies with the stringent requirements of the recently released ISO18385. This standard specifies the demands on manufacturers of products which are used in forensic DNA laboratories to further minimize the risk of contamination. Eppendorf confirms the compliance for every production lot and provides lot-specific certificates. The comprehensive approach of this product line assures an excellent purity and performance level as well as optimized packaging that supports contamination- and error-free handling.

The Forensic DNA Grade products encompass consumables for DNA extraction, sample processing and PCR setup as well as for sample storage.
